linux命令检查状态
-
Linux命令可以用来检查系统的状态、进程的状态、硬件设备的状态等。下面列举一些常用的Linux命令来检查不同状态:
1. 检查系统状态:
– `top`:查看系统的实时进程信息,包括CPU、内存、进程等指标。
– `htop`:与top类似,但提供更方便的交互式界面。
– `df`:查看文件系统的磁盘使用情况。
– `free`:查看系统的内存使用情况。
– `vmstat`:查看系统的虚拟内存、系统活动、进程状态等。
– `iostat`:查看系统的磁盘IO情况。
– `netstat`:查看网络连接状态。
– `uptime`:查看系统的运行时间和负载情况。2. 检查进程状态:
– `ps`:查看系统的进程状态,包括进程ID、CPU、内存占用等。
– `top`:如上所述,可以实时查看进程的状态。3. 检查硬件设备状态:
– `lsusb`:列出USB设备的信息。
– `lspci`:列出PCI设备的信息。
– `lsblk`:列出块设备的信息,如硬盘、分区等。
– `lscpu`:列出CPU信息。以上只是列举了一些常用的命令,还有其他的命令可以用来检查状态,具体可以根据实际需求选择合适的命令。可以使用命令的帮助文档或者在终端中输入命令名加上`–help`选项来获取更详细的帮助信息。
2年前 -
Linux是一个开放源代码的操作系统,它提供了许多命令来检查系统状态和执行管理任务。下面是一些常用的Linux命令,可以用来检查系统状态。
1. `top`命令:用于实时监控系统中的进程和系统性能。它显示了当前CPU使用情况、内存使用情况、进程列表等信息。可以按照不同的排序方式来查看进程的优先级和资源消耗情况。
2. `htop`命令:类似于`top`命令,但提供了更多的交互式功能和信息。它可以显示每个进程的树状结构、进程的资源使用情况以及进程的状态(如运行、睡眠、僵尸等)。
3. `free`命令:用于查看系统的内存使用情况。它可以显示可用内存、已用内存、缓存和交换空间等信息。可以使用`-h`选项以更友好的方式显示内存大小。
4. `df`命令:用于查看磁盘空间使用情况。它可以显示每个磁盘分区的总容量、已使用容量和可用容量。可以使用`-h`选项以更友好的方式显示磁盘大小。
5. `netstat`命令:用于显示网络连接和网络统计信息。它可以显示已建立的连接、监听的端口、传输的数据包等信息。可以使用不同的选项来过滤显示结果,例如`-t`用于显示TCP连接,`-u`用于显示UDP连接等。
6. `ifconfig`命令:用于查看和配置网络接口信息。它可以显示系统中所有网络接口的IP地址、MAC地址、网络状态等信息。可以使用不同的选项来获取特定接口的信息。
7. `ps`命令:用于列出当前系统中的进程信息。它可以显示进程的ID、父进程ID、状态、运行时间等信息。可以使用不同的选项来过滤和排序显示结果。
8. `uptime`命令:用于显示系统的运行时间和平均负载。它可以显示系统自启动以来的运行时间,并显示最近1、5、15分钟的平均负载。可以使用`-p`选项来以可读的方式显示运行时间。
2年前 -
在Linux系统中,可以使用多种命令来检查系统的状态。根据检查的对象可以分为以下几个方面。
1. 检查系统信息
可以使用以下命令来查看Linux系统的基本信息:
– `uname -a`:显示系统内核版本以及其他相关信息。
– `cat /etc/os-release`:显示Linux系统的发行版信息。
– `lsb_release -a`:显示Linux发行版的详细信息。2. 检查CPU状态
可以使用以下命令来检查CPU的状态:
– `top`:实时显示系统CPU使用情况。
– `mpstat`:显示系统或每个CPU的平均利用率和统计信息。
– `lscpu`:显示关于CPU体系结构的信息。3. 检查内存状态
可以使用以下命令来检查内存的状态:
– `free -h`:显示系统的内存使用情况。
– `vmstat`:报告虚拟内存状态。
– `ps -eo pid,ppid,%mem,%cpu,cmd`:显示进程的内存和CPU使用情况。4. 检查磁盘状态
可以使用以下命令来检查磁盘状态:
– `df -h`:显示磁盘空间的使用情况。
– `du -h`:显示文件夹的磁盘空间使用情况。
– `iotop`:实时监控磁盘I/O活动。5. 检查网络状态
可以使用以下命令来检查网络状态:
– `ifconfig`:显示网络接口信息。
– `netstat -an`:显示网络连接状态。
– `ping`:测试与指定主机的连通性。
– `traceroute`:显示数据包到达目的地经过的路由器。6. 检查进程状态
可以使用以下命令来检查进程的状态:
– `ps -ef`:显示系统的所有进程。
– `top`:实时显示系统的进程和资源使用情况。
– `htop`:基于ncurses的交互式进程查看器。7. 检查服务状态
可以使用以下命令来检查服务的状态:
– `systemctl status`:显示系统服务的状态。
– `service [service_name] status`:显示指定服务的状态。这些命令只是列举了常用的检查系统状态的命令,Linux系统上还有许多其他有用的命令可用于监视和调试系统。可以通过查阅相关文档或使用命令的`–help`参数了解更多细节。
2年前